The Tarivault tax-rate lookup cache runs in three environments: dev, staging, and production. Dev refreshes rates hourly from a synthetic feed; staging and production pull from the upstream rate authority nightly. If support sees stale-rate complaints, check the cache age metric before escalating. Each environment shares the same schema but differs in the values shown below.

settings of fafog-haduf:
ZORIX_PIN=4648
ZORIX_METRICS_HOST=metrics.zorix.paliqsys.corp
ZORIX_LOG_LEVEL=info
ZORIX_TENANT=druix

## Changelog — Almswire receipt mailer v2.8

Renamed `MAILER_TOKEN` to reflect scoped usage; the old name is removed, not aliased. Deploys carrying the old key will fail at boot with a config error, by design. Action for this week: update every environment file for the donation-receipt mailer before Thursday's cut. Templates, retry logic, and the SMTP pool are unchanged; only the variable name moved. For reference, the updated env file must contain the following line.

vault entry, kafog-yahop: COURIER_KEY8=0faa53ae

It runs in three environments: dev (single-car scenarios, fast tick rate), staging (full 12-car bank, mirrors production traffic replays), and prod (feeds the live capacity dashboard). Each environment differs only in tick rate, car count, and replay source; the simulation engine binary is identical. Maintainers should never hand-edit prod settings directly — change dev first, then promote. The baseline configuration shared by all environments is listed below.

deployment values, yadug-bawif:
[framir]
team = pelox
access_code = ac_a38ab2
owner = tamion.julael
host = framir.tolvaqlabs.test
port = 11211
peer = tammir.zemvargrid.local
salt = 2215ef03
pin = 1541

Handover: WavePeek preview service (from Dario to Lenka). The waveform preview renders amplitude tiles server-side; all uploads pass through the Quarrel sanitizer before decoding, and decode workers run in a locked-down pool with no outbound network. Please verify the sandbox flags and tile cache TTLs against policy before sign-off. The active configuration for the preview workers is listed below.

config for taguf-tafof:
zorath:
  log_level: error
  metrics_host: metrics.zorath.zemvarlabs.internal
  pin: 5550
  pool_size: 32